Tempus Fugit Provide dramatic costumed historical and storytelling workshops directly relating to the revised National Curriculum study units for English and History, providing stimulus for your Literacy Hour and History Topic.

Each show has been specifically devised to provide a FULL FUN FILLED hour of LEARNING AND ENTERTAINMENT. Children are given the opportunity to be directly involved in the drama, to dress in costumes, to handle artefacts, to experience music and dance of each age.

All the shows are performed by a fully qualified and experienced teacher - actor - musician.

Each show is carefully written to act as a stimulus for and a supplement to your topic and is carefully linked to National Curriculum requirements.
